> Do not apply the RX checksum settings to hardware if the interface is
> down.
> In case runtime PM is enabled, and while the interface is down, the IP
> will be in reset mode (as for some platforms disabling the clocks will
> switch the IP to reset mode, which will lead to losing register contents)
> and applying settings in reset mode is not an option. Instead, cache the
> RX checksum settings and apply them in ravb_open() through
> ravb_emac_init().
> This has been solved by introducing pm_runtime_active() check. The device
> runtime PM usage counter has been incremented to avoid disabling the
> device clocks while the check is in progress (if any).
>
> Commit prepares for the addition of runtime PM.
